diff options
author | Stephen Gallagher <sgallagh@redhat.com> | 2010-11-15 14:58:17 -0500 |
---|---|---|
committer | Stephen Gallagher <sgallagh@redhat.com> | 2010-11-15 15:52:10 -0500 |
commit | 5e4ea20cf1e31ce4fee5cbfa92ea120901a5bd1e (patch) | |
tree | 89b2d6cbd4d75ecbd294662e3e71f072610a0545 | |
parent | f8a60e728780a8230ed4fa9c5350fa94534f0543 (diff) | |
download | sssd-5e4ea20cf1e31ce4fee5cbfa92ea120901a5bd1e.tar.gz sssd-5e4ea20cf1e31ce4fee5cbfa92ea120901a5bd1e.tar.bz2 sssd-5e4ea20cf1e31ce4fee5cbfa92ea120901a5bd1e.zip |
Fix const cast warning in confdb_create_ldif
-rw-r--r-- | src/confdb/confdb_setup.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/src/confdb/confdb_setup.c b/src/confdb/confdb_setup.c index f98a6977..6c68461f 100644 --- a/src/confdb/confdb_setup.c +++ b/src/confdb/confdb_setup.c @@ -128,7 +128,7 @@ int confdb_create_base(struct confdb_ctx *cdb) static int confdb_create_ldif(TALLOC_CTX *mem_ctx, struct collection_item *sssd_config, - char **config_ldif) + const char **config_ldif) { int ret, i, j; char *ldif; @@ -260,7 +260,7 @@ static int confdb_create_ldif(TALLOC_CTX *mem_ctx, free_section_list(sections); - *config_ldif = ldif; + *config_ldif = (const char *)ldif; talloc_free(tmp_ctx); return EOK; @@ -276,7 +276,7 @@ int confdb_init_db(const char *config_file, struct confdb_ctx *cdb) struct collection_item *sssd_config = NULL; struct collection_item *error_list = NULL; struct collection_item *item = NULL; - char *config_ldif; + const char *config_ldif; struct ldb_ldif *ldif; TALLOC_CTX *tmp_ctx; char *lasttimestr, timestr[21]; @@ -395,7 +395,7 @@ int confdb_init_db(const char *config_file, struct confdb_ctx *cdb) DEBUG(7, ("LDIF file to import: \n%s", config_ldif)); - while ((ldif = ldb_ldif_read_string(cdb->ldb, (const char **)&config_ldif))) { + while ((ldif = ldb_ldif_read_string(cdb->ldb, &config_ldif))) { ret = ldb_add(cdb->ldb, ldif->msg); if (ret != LDB_SUCCESS) { DEBUG(0, ("Failed to initialize DB (%d,[%s]), aborting!\n", |